DESCRIPTION:No. 72240
Mineral:Azurite
Locality:Touissit Mine, 21 km SSE of Oujda, Jerada Province, Oriental, Morocco
Description:Lustrous translucent dark-blue azurite crystals with remnants of brown matrix on the bottom end. The azurite crystals are elongated prismatic form, with striated prism faces, and complex terminations. The rear was sawn to reduce bulk without damage. Ex. G. McLoughlin collection, acquired from Arnold Goldstein (1941-2020)
Overall Size:5.5x2x1.5 cm
Crystals:9-46 mm
